Carbon atoms on surface of diamond unsaturated?

In a fit of largesse I bought four sets of organic chemistry model pieces (molymod), confident that I had overcome the only thing that prevented me from modeling the structures of diamond and graphite for my kids’ class at the local lapidary society–i.e., not enough four-hole carbon atoms.

Sadly, my ignorance seems to be a barrier, too!

After four hours I proudly presented my completed diamond model to my daughter, who said, “Um, Mom, shouldn’t it be an octahedron?” “It IS an octahedron!” I protested, until I counted the sides. Nope, I’d somehow managed to construct a TETRAHEDRON. I had to start over (daughter’s hands aren’t strong enough to snap the pieces together, or I’d have her do it).

I now have an octahedron…but I won’t show it to my kids for fear that they’ll ask me, “Why do all the carbons on the outside of the diamond still have one hole left over?” Because I dunno.

So, are those surface atoms double-bonded, or bonded to junk on the surface, or ?
